How Pocket Sliding Doors Optimize Space in Your Home
Barn sliding doors bring charm and character, but pocket sliding doors present a practical solution for optimizing space in a home. These clever doors tuck neatly into the wall, doing away with the need for swing space that conventional doors require. This solution helps homeowners maximize their living areas, especially in smaller rooms where every inch matters.
Pocket sliding doors are ideal for tight spaces, such as closets or bathrooms, where traditional doors may restrict movement. Their sleek appearance also contributes to a sleek aesthetic, making them an attractive option for contemporary interiors. Furthermore, pocket doors can improve the connection between rooms, fostering an open feel while offering privacy as required.
In essence, pocket sliding doors unite elegance with functionality, making them an excellent option for residential property owners aiming to make the most of their space without sacrificing style.
Critical Aspects to Evaluate When Selecting a Sliding Door for Your Home?
What factors should one consider when selecting the ideal sliding door for their home? Selecting a sliding door involves several key considerations to guarantee it complements both functionality and aesthetics. To begin with, the material plays a critical role; choices such as wood, glass, and metal each bring unique aesthetic qualities and lasting strength. Additionally, the dimensions of the door should correspond to the designated area, ensuring a perfect fit that improves movement while allowing ample natural light.
Additionally, consideration should be given to the design and style—whether a sleek, minimalist style or a more classic appearance best complements the home. Security aspects should not be overlooked; heavy-duty locks and tempered glass work together to strengthen safety.
Lastly, financial considerations play a role in the choice, as sliding doors are available in a wide range of prices based on customizations and materials. By evaluating these key factors, homeowners can carefully choose a sliding door that complements their home.

How Can I Maintain Sliding Doors for Long-Term Use?
To maintain sliding doors for longevity, consistent maintenance of tracks, proper roller lubrication, and inspection for wear are essential. Ensuring proper alignment and resolving problems quickly can significantly improve their durability and performance.
Do Sliding Doors Help Improve Energy Efficiency?
Sliding doors can improve energy efficiency when they are correctly installed and sealed. Modern designs often feature double glazing and insulated frames, minimising heat loss and improving climate control, ultimately lowering energy bills and increasing comfort within the home.
What Are the Best Materials for Sliding Doors?
Aluminum, fiberglass, and vinyl stand as ideal choices for sliding doors owing to their strength, minimal upkeep, and energy-saving properties. Wood offers aesthetic appeal but necessitates additional care to avoid moisture-related warping and deterioration.

How Much Do Sliding Doors Typically Cost?
Sliding doors typically range in cost anywhere from $300 to $2,500, depending on materials, design, and installation. Custom options and high-end materials can greatly increase the overall price, while basic models tend to stay more budget-friendly.
